Wellness getaways are more popular than ever. According to research from Virtuoso, searches for “wellness retreats” are up a whopping 280 percent. The team at Cult Beauty analyzed cities in Europe to determine the most popular destinations for a European wellness getaway.

 

The top 20 European wellness destinations are:

  1. Paris, France
  2. London, United Kingdom
  3. Helsinki, Finland
  4. Copenhagen, Denmark
  5. Vienna, Austria
  6. Prague, Czech Republic
  7. Edinburgh, United Kingdom
  8. The Hague, Netherlands
  9. Rotterdam, Netherlands
  10. Amsterdam, Netherlands
  11. Oslo, Norway
  12. Madrid, Spain
  13. Luxembourg, Luxembourg
  14. Minsk, Belarus
  15. Reykjavik, Iceland
  16. Vilnius, Lithuania
  17. Berlin, Germany
  18. Stockholm, Sweden
  19. Munich, Germany
  20. Barcelona, Spain

 

Paris took the top spot on the list thanks in part to ranking highest for health care, least pollution and most spas (more than 1,000). London came in second, with its record-breaking number of green spaces. With the highest happiness ranking on the list, Helsinki comes in third place overall. No. 4 on the list, Copenhagen offers free healthcare and a healthy work-life balance. Vienna rounds out the top five with its high quality of life index ranking.

 

The cities were ranked using seven factors: quality of life, health care, cost of living, pollution, number of parks, number of spas and wellness centers, and happiness levels. For more information on methodology, visit the website.

Corendon Dutch Airlines Launches “Tattooed” Aircraft

Corendon Dutch Airlines recently celebrated its 25th anniversary by unveiling some eye-catching new livery. The airline partnered with tattooist to celebrities, Henk Schiffmacher, to create what it’s now calling the first fully tattooed aircraft in the world.

Aspen Snowmass Breaks Ground on New Projects

Aspen Snowmass, part of Aspen One, has officially broken ground on a new $80 million project of on-mountain improvement projects, including two new high-speed chairlifts, a complete reconstruction of an on-mountain restaurant and more. These new upgrades are part of an effort by Aspen One to upgrade on-mountain infrastructure in the coming years to remain one of North America’s premier mountain resort destinations.

What to Expect from First-Ever Mexican Caribbean Music Festival

This year, Mexican Caribbean Tourism launches the first-ever Mexican Caribbean Music Festival. The one-day festival takes place May 17, and will welcome a variety of artists to Tulum’s ZAMNA venue. This year’s headliner will be Sting. The best part? The festival is totally free and family-friendly, although you do need to reserve tickets in advance.
